Cool Old Photos Show Willie Mays As You've Never Seen Him, I.E. Starting A Pillow Fight
Today, as they tend to do, the LIFE photography archives released a beautiful selection of never-before-seen photographs. The new collection, released 60 years to the day after Willie Mays' major league debut on May 25, 1951, is of the Hall of Famer's earlier years as a professional baseball player. There are many more photos (by Loomis Dean, Alfred Eisenstaedt, and Ralph Morse) over at the ; this one, of Mays pelting Monte Irvin with a pillow in their hotel room, is an obvious favorite. "I've got a couple of kids, 6 and 10 years old," Irvin said to LIFE in 1954, "but when I take a road trip I've got another one on my hands. That Willie is 23 years old and he'll drink maybe seven big sodas and a dozen Cokes in 12 hours."
